What is a manufacturing representative?

Manufacturing Representatives, also known as manufacturers' reps or sales representatives, are professionals who act as intermediaries between manufacturing companies and their customers. They promote and sell a manufacturer's products to wholesalers, retailers, and other businesses, usually within a specific territory. These representatives often work on commission and may represent multiple manufacturers at once, helping businesses find the right products while providing valuable market feedback to manufacturers.

How does a manufacturing representative typically interact with production and sales teams to meet client needs?

A Manufacturing Representative acts as a vital link between manufacturers and clients, frequently collaborating with both production and sales teams. They communicate client specifications and feedback to the production team to ensure that products meet quality and delivery expectations. At the same time, they work closely with sales teams to understand market demands and provide technical support during the sales process. This collaborative environment helps ensure that customer requirements are met efficiently and any issues are resolved quickly, making strong interpersonal and communication skills essential for success in the role.

What is the difference between Manufacturing Representative vs Sales Engineer?

AspectManufacturing RepresentativeSales Engineer
CredentialsTypically sales or industry-specific certifications, high school diploma or equivalentEngineering degree or technical certifications often required
Work EnvironmentField-based, visiting clients and manufacturing sitesOffice and client site visits, technical presentations
Employer & Industry UsageManufacturers, distributors, and sales agenciesManufacturers, engineering firms, technical sales
Search & Comparison IntentUnderstanding sales roles in manufacturingTechnical sales and product explanation

The main difference is that Manufacturing Representatives focus on selling products on behalf of manufacturers, often without deep technical knowledge, while Sales Engineers combine technical expertise with sales skills to explain complex products to clients. Both roles involve client interaction and sales, but Sales Engineers typically require technical degrees and provide more technical support during the sales process.

Job description

NOW HIRING: We are looking for a Manufacturing Methods Engineer is responsible for creating and maintaining accurate Bills of Material (BOMs), routings, and related part master data in Epicor ERP (and supporting tools such as Cadlink) for the Transportation & Infrastructure (Pole) business unit. This role ensures the integrity of ERP part data and settings by interpreting complex part design specifications and Manufacturing Process Engineer inputs. By building accurate Methods of Manufacturing (MOM), this position guarantees that production systems reflect intended processes, directly driving operational accuracy and efficiency for the Transportation & Infrastructure Business Unit.

Job Title: Manufacturing Methods Engineer
Location: Onsite in Winsted, MN
Salary Range: $74,286 - $88,912/year (Exempt role)
(In compliance with Minnesota Pay Transparency Law, this range reflects the anticipated compensation for this role. Actual pay may vary based on experience, education, and other factors.)
Shift Schedule: 1st shift Monday – Friday Business Hours
Shift Differential
: 1st shift N/A

Key Roles and Responsibilities:

  • Manage Bills of Material (BOM) and routings
  • Ensure Epicor Part data integrity of standards
  • Translate product drawings to manufacturing routings
  • Implement Engineering Change Methods Updates & Notices (ECN)
  • Drive cross-functional alignment

As a Manufacturing Methods Engineer, you will:

  • Own creation and maintenance of BOMs, routings, and part master data for T&I projects in Epicor ERP and related tools
  • Create and maintain new and existing parts, BOMs, and routings in Epicor ERP based on engineering and drafting drawings, established standards, and changing manufacturing requirements
  • Maintain part master supporting documentation required for planning, inventory control, and shop floor execution
  • Ensure data integrity and standards compliance through audits, corrections, disciplined change control, and support for validated mass updates
  • Execute production drawing build packet processing by translating engineering drawings into production-ready documentation and creating new parts through established workflows
  • Review Engineering Change Orders (ECOs) and implement BOM and routing updates in a timely manner to prevent use of outdated versions
  • Collaborate cross-functionally with Drafting, Engineering, Operations, Quality, and P&S to validate routing, resolve requirements issues, and communicate methods changes
  • Document and maintain methods standards, work instructions, and training materials
  • Support standardization and continuous improvement of methods processes, documentation, and workflow enhancements, including evaluation of tool capabilities as requested
